Saving Stitch Patterns to USB Media
(Commercially Available)
When sending stitch patterns from the machine to USB
media, plug the USB media into the machine’s USB
port. Depending on the type of USB media being used,
either directly plug the USB device into the machine’s
USB port or plug the USB Card Writer/Reader into the
machine’s USB port.
